Whole Genome Assembly of Human Papillomavirus by Nanopore Long-Read Sequencing
4 Jan 2022
Abstract excerpt
Human papillomavirus (HPV) is a causal agent for most cervical cancers. The physical status of the HPV genome in these cancers could be episomal, integrated, or both. HPV integration could serve as a biomarker for clinical diagnosis, treatment, and prognosis.
